I have found that the best way to heal is to tell the truth of my own story and that the best way to help is to listen to another’s truth. Speaking our stories sets us free. Alive & Kicking is a podcast where I talk to people about their path of waking up to the truth of who they really are, what they really want and why they came here. What we learn is that the breakdowns we experience aren't failures; they're accelerators to the breakthroughs. And, what we thought of as our disasters was later revealed as our deliverance. When we willingly step into the open space of real and vulnerable dialogue, healing becomes possible for us all.

    This week's guest is BakeR Gendron, whose life took her from a small town in rural Indiana to Chicago, California and Phoenix where she served as a political activist supporting LGBTQ rights, leading a life which transcended labels. That journey took an abrupt turn toward the spiritual while tending to her dying partner as she began experiencing flashbacks of previously buried trauma. Decades of healing gave her the compassionate wisdom to serve others to develop the skills and insight to begin to heal themselves.

    Intuitive reader, spiritual healer, coach and teacher, BakeR Gendron is the Director of Gateway Cottage Wellness Center in Sedona, Arizona. She has worked for decades, both privately and with groups, to empower clients to live life fully and joyously! Assisting to remove barriers to success, happiness and wellbeing, she facilitates holistic healing by integrating mind, body, and spirit. Through BakeR’s own healing journey, recovering from childhood trauma and abuse, she is inspired to teach others how to heal themselves, and to facilitate healthy change. She facilitates spiritual retreats and classes for people seeking to make major life changes and to connect with their own higher selves.

    An existential crisis can throw the average adult into a state of uncertainty at best and inner turmoil at worst. Kay's next guest, John Schieke, was just six years old when he started to ponder the deepest questions. As a child, he was mentally and emotionally ill-equipped to handle these queries and barely had the vocabulary to describe what he was experiencing to others. The resulting alienation and stress made him vulnerable to the substance abuse that, by the age of 18, very nearly took his life. Now sober, John shares his ongoing journey from confusion to clarity and offers hope to young people struggling with similar challenges.

    Catalina was born in Colombia in 1981 into a violent family, in a dangerous neighborhood in a turbulent time. She lived in continuous, extreme physical and emotional trauma, without noticing she was completely burying her past. Later, while living in Paris, after a night of heavy drinking, she was plunged into a situation that triggered a physical knowing that she had been raped. But because there was no clear evidence, there was no proof that a crime had been committed. Thus, she began to feel the terror of losing her mind. Her chaotic lifestyle continued until the responsibility, drugs, alcohol, sleeplessness and uncontrollably racing mind brought her body to severe illness and her mind to the breaking point. Depressed, suicidal and facing a possible hysterectomy to remove fibroid tumors, she heard a voice encouraging her to take a path of true healing rather than surgery.

    Six years later, Catalina is living in peace and no longer allows her past to unconsciously run everything. She does not claim to be a teacher, to be enlightened or to know it all. She only knows that all of her pain has been created by a misunderstanding of what was happening. She believes we are powerful creators having a unique experience that is meant to add something to the divinely perfect tapestry of LIFE.

    In this episode of Alive & Kicking, Lisa Stokke talks with Kay about being parented, parenting adults and the unique challenges of mothering in the age of awakening.
    As founder and Executive Director of Next 7, an organization that advocates for healthy food systems, Lisa has been working to bring awareness to the importance of organic and regenerative agriculture. Previously, inspired by the lack of clean food choices for her four children, she co-founded Food Democracy Now! She works with farmers, scientists and policy leaders around the world  to increase nutrient density in food and crops.
    A 20-year passion for plant medicine led her to start Temple Tree Aromatics – a company that sources sustainably wildcrafted and organic botanical essential oils and functional blends.
    She lives in Boulder, CO.
